In this topic, I would like to suggest only one feature: the ability for the commissioner to manually add the game result and choose how the game ended — in regulation time or in overtime. In the current version, the commissioner can add a result, but only as a 1:0 score. This is not always enough. Below are a few examples where a 1:0 technical result does not solve the problem. Example 1 MTL vs NYR. Score: 2:2. Regulation time ends, overtime starts, and then there is a lost connection. Because of this, the game result is not added to the standings. If the players restart the game and play until the first goal, and then the commissioner adds the result manually, it still does not show that the game ended in overtime. Because of this, the points in the standings can be wrong, and the league table can also be sorted incorrectly. Example 2 MTL vs NYR. Score: 10:2. The third period starts. NYR is tilted and wants to leave the game, but both players want to keep this score. If NYR leaves the match, the result will not be added to the standings. The commissioner can only add a 1:0 result. This can also affect the standings, because MTL should have more goals scored and a better goal difference. There is one possible workaround, but it is not good for everyone and not always possible. If there is a random lost connection, players can try to recreate the match. For example, in Example 1, they can make the score 2:2 again, wait until overtime starts, and then play seriously. But this is not a real solution, because it takes valuable time that players could spend playing other league games. So my main and most urgent suggestion for Connected Franchise is: Please give the commissioner a tool to manually add the game score and choose the game ending type — regulation time or overtime. Hi EA NHL Team, I’m really happy to see Connected Franchise return in NHL 27, but there is one major issue that currently prevents my friends and me from playing the mode the way we expected. We are a small group of 3–4 players. We each want to control our own NHL team while the remaining teams are controlled by the CPU, just like in a normal Franchise Mode. For example, if we control Florida, Boston, Chicago and Edmonton, we would like the other 28 NHL teams to continue functioning normally as CPU-controlled franchises. They should be able to make trades, manage their rosters, sign players and participate in the league just like they do in offline Franchise Mode. Ideally, Connected Franchise would eventually include: CPU-controlled teams alongside human-controlled teams • Multiple seasons • Player progression, regression and aging • Rookie/Entry Draft and draft picks • CPU trades and roster management • Contracts and free agency • Prospects and player development • Fantasy Draft For us, CPU-controlled teams are by far the most important feature. It is very difficult to organize a league with 32 real players. Being able to create a league with a few friends and have the CPU control the remaining teams would completely change the experience. Essentially, we would love Connected Franchise to become the regular Franchise Mode experience, but online with friends. I understand that this is Year 1 of Connected Franchise and that the mode will continue to evolve. I really hope CPU teams and a true multi-season franchise experience are among the highest priorities.
